Collector receives 35 petitions at higher education grievances camp in Erode
AI Summary

The district Collector of Erode held a special grievances camp to address 35 petitions from students and parents regarding higher education and administrative support. The initiative aims to streamline access to scholarships, loans, and government coaching programs.

The district Collector S. Kandasamy on Tuesday (July 14, 2026) received 35 petitions from students and their parents at a higher education guidance programme and special grievances redress camp held at the Collectorate.
